There are 100 cards in a bag on which numbers from 1 to 100 are written. A card is taken out from the bag at random. Find the probability that the number on the selected card |
(i) is divisible by 9 and is a perfect square, |
(ii) is a prime number greater than 80. |
Answer:
Number of possible outcomes \[=100\] (i) Let \[{{E}_{1}}\] be the event of getting a number divisible by 9 and is a perfect square. \[\therefore \] Favourable outcomes \[=\{9,36,81\}\] Number of favourable outcomes \[=3\] \[\therefore P({{E}_{1}})=\frac{3}{100}\] (ii) Let \[{{E}_{2}}\] be the event of getting a prime number greater than 80. \[\therefore \] Favourable outcomes \[=\{83,89,97\}\] Number of favourable outcomes \[=3\] \[\therefore P({{E}_{2}})=\frac{3}{100}\]
